In Australia, a full time Milliner Assistant generally earns $1,100 per week ($57,200 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

There has been stable job growth in the millinery industry in Australia in recent years. The industry employs a small number of people though and there are currently 180 people working as a Milliner or Milliner Assistant. Milliner Assistants will generally find work in larger towns and cities.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

If you’re planning to begin a career as a Milliner Assistant, consider enrolling in a Certificate II in Applied Fashion Design and Technology. This course is a great introduction to the industry and will explore basic design concepts. You may decide to further your study with a Certificate III in Applied Fashion Design and Technology.
